Overview
Level Field is a field type in WPS Office for Mac Bitable. It helps you define multiple level options in advance and organize records by level for clearer classification and review. It works well for customer tiering, task priority, service levels, and other workflows that need a consistent grading structure.
Core tasks include:
- Create a Level Field: add a dedicated level-based field from the field type list.
- Set the number of levels: adjust how many levels are available for the field.
- Assign colors to levels: use different colors to distinguish each level more clearly.

Use Cases
| No. | Scenario | Suitable for | Main challenge | How Level Field helps |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Customer tier management | Sales and customer success teams | Customer levels are not consistent | Use Level Field to define tiers such as Standard, Silver, and Gold |
| 2 | Task priority tracking | Project managers and execution teams | Priority is hard to identify quickly | Use Level Field to mark low, medium, and high priority |
| 3 | Service level records | Operations and support teams | Service categories are not unified | Use Level Field to record service levels consistently |
| 4 | Risk grading | Managers and reviewers | Risk records lack a shared standard | Use Level Field to build fixed risk levels |
| 5 | Quality check classification | QA and process teams | Results are difficult to summarize quickly | Use Level Field with colors to separate quality levels |
